What does it actually look like to homeschool five kids across wildly different ages — while running a business, managing a rambunctious toddler, and doing it all on one income?

This week I'm joined by Amanda, a homeschool mom of five from St. Augustine, Florida. Amanda started homeschooling when her family left Germany in 2020 — one week before the world shut down. What felt like a leap of faith turned out to be the best thing she ever did.

We talk about:
→ Why Amanda and her husband felt called to homeschool even before COVID
→ What it's really like managing school with multiple ages under one roof (spoiler: it's not always pretty)
→ How Florida's PEP Scholarship is a total game-changer for families homeschooling on one income
→ The year-round model that actually relieved her stress
→ How she built Giplings — her small business inspired entirely by her homeschool journey
→ The car conversations, the lizard hunts, and the little moments that are the real education

Whether you're just starting out or years in, Amanda's honesty about the chaos — and why she wouldn't trade it — will leave you feeling seen.
